The Vibrant Campus Environment


A Supportive Community


At GIN Nursing Colleges, students are welcomed into a supportive community that fosters collaboration and camaraderie. The campus is designed to encourage interaction among students, faculty, and staff. This environment is crucial for nursing students, who often face rigorous academic challenges.


  • Peer Support Groups: Many colleges offer peer support groups where students can share experiences, study together, and provide emotional support.

  • Mentorship Programs: Faculty members often serve as mentors, guiding students through their academic journey and offering advice on career paths.


Engaging Extracurricular Activities


Campus life at GIN Nursing Colleges is not just about academics; it also includes a variety of extracurricular activities that help students develop leadership skills and build friendships.


  • Student Organizations: There are numerous student organizations focused on nursing and healthcare, such as the Student Nurses Association. These organizations provide networking opportunities and host events that enhance learning.

  • Volunteer Opportunities: Students are encouraged to participate in community service projects, which not only benefit the community but also provide practical experience in patient care.


Academic Opportunities


Hands-On Learning Experiences


One of the standout features of GIN Nursing Colleges is the emphasis on hands-on learning. Students have access to state-of-the-art simulation labs that mimic real-life medical scenarios.


  • Simulation Labs: These labs allow students to practice clinical skills in a safe environment, preparing them for real-world situations they will encounter in their nursing careers.

  • Clinical Rotations: Students participate in clinical rotations at local hospitals and healthcare facilities, gaining valuable experience and exposure to various nursing specialties.
